Does AAV-mediated delivery of a CaMKII peptide inhibitor suppress arrhythmias in preclinical models of CPVT?
Gene therapy using AAV-mediated delivery of a CaMKII peptide inhibitor provides proof-of-concept for suppressing arrhythmias in CPVT.
This proof-of-concept study showed that AAV-mediated delivery of a CaMKII peptide inhibitor to the heart was effective in suppressing arrhythmias in a murine model of CPVT. CaMKII inhibition also reversed the arrhythmia phenotype in human CPVT induced pluripotent stem cell-derived cardiomyocyte models with different pathogenic mutations.
